Proposed Federal Senate Legislation SB428
Legislation Overview
Title: FIND Act Firearm Industry Non-Discrimination Act
Subject: Government operations and politics
Description: A bill to amend title 41, United States Code, to prohibit the Federal Government from entering into contracts with an entity that discriminates against firearm or ammunition industries, and for other purposes.
Session: 118th Congress
Last Action: Read twice and referred to the Committee on Homeland Security and Governmental Affairs.
Last Action Date: February 15, 2023
Link: https://www.congress.gov/bill/118th-congress/senate-bill/428/all-info
Companion Bill: HB53
